### Step 4: Apply remediation config

Per the Quillhaven stale-cache postmortem, the old invalidation settings allowed entries to outlive their source records by hours. Before promoting build 14.2, replace the cache tier's config with the corrected values below. Do not merge with existing overrides; the postmortem traced the bug to a partial override. Verify all three regions restart cleanly, then sign off in the release tracker. The corrected configuration to apply is as follows.

config for faweg-yajef:
DRUIX_HOST=druix.lumicsys.internal
DRUIX_PORT=9000

- [ ] Step 7: Archive cold storage buckets (Glacierline tier). Confirm both ceremony witnesses are present, verify bucket manifests match the Oxbow ledger, then seal the archive key shares. Plugin authors may observe but not handle shares. Once sealed, the archive index itself is encrypted and can only be reopened with the passphrase below.

vault phrase of badup-hahig = tamael-aldael-kelmir-istael-fenok-istwyn-tamius-jorath-oliion

### Key Ceremony Checklist — Item 7: LogLantern Viewer Unlock

Before the witnesses leave the room, confirm the LogLantern audit-log viewer can decrypt the sealed ceremony records. Have the custodian from the Brindlemoor office verify the hardware token count matches the sign-in sheet, then initial the margin. If the viewer prompts for emergency credentials, use the recovery passphrase recorded below this item.

unlock words, hahip-yagef: zorok-novmir-zorix-silax

Handover note — Crumbwheel order cutoffs.

Welcome aboard. The bakery cutoff rule in Crumbwheel closes same-day orders at 14:00 local to each storefront, not UTC — this has bitten us twice. Holiday overrides live in the calendar service and take precedence silently, so always check there first when a cutoff looks wrong. To unlock the calendar service's admin console after a restart, enter the recovery passphrase below.

vault phrase of bagap-bahaf = silion-pelox-sorox-casdor-quenwyn-fraax-eliox-praael-kelion-quenvan-kasox-rusael-norius-belvan